Disabled Protesters Blockade The BBC

Disabled protesters from DPAC, Black Triangle, Mental  Health Resistance Network and others blockaded a BBC building today in protest at the corporation’s shameful parroting of DWP lies.

Ever since this Government weren’t elected ministers like Iain Duncan Smith and Lord Fraud have misused statistics and even lied outright to smear disabled benefit claimants as scroungers or frauds.  These lies have been repeated without criticism by the toadying BBC who have become little more than a spineless mouthpiece for DWP spin.

This has all taken place against a savage backdrop of cuts to benefits, housing and local services which are forcing thousands of disabled people into brutal poverty, homelessness and tragically even suicide.  This side of the story has rarely been shown on the BBC.

Today disabled people fought back, blockading the entrance to their building in Portland Place.  Watch the video above.
